English Regents Examination (Levels of
Performance of Students with Disabilities, 1997-2002*)
*Data are from the OLAP file.
Compared to 1997, in 2002 a 219 percent increase
was achieved for the number of students with disabilities tested for the Regents
Examination in English, and of the students tested, 61 percent scored 55-100.
Almost twice as many students with disabilities passed the examination in 2002
than took it in 1997.
